A 409A valuation refers to an appraisal of the fair market value of the common stock of a private company by an independent valuation firm. Typically, startups pay a fee for this assessment and then use the finding to inform the correct prce at which employees can purchase shares of the company’s common stock. These valuations are essential for companies because they impact everything from employee stock options to tax implications. Formal Approval For Fairness & Transparency

After the comprehensive review, the  Board of Directors must formally approve the 409A valuation. If there are any discrepancies or concerns with the valuation report it’s important to address them properly. It is a critical process that valuation must be fair and justifiable. The valuation approval should be documented carefully in the minutes of the board meeting, accurate assessment, providing a clear record of the decision-making procedure.

Regular Updates and Reassessments For Adapting Market Trends and Events

Valuation is not limited, the Board of Directors in 409A Valuation Approval ensures that the 409A report is updated and matches trends at least annually or whenever events happen such as economic conditions, funding rounds, industry trends, revenue and profit changes, tax policy changes, innovations, and new technologies. Regular updates in valuation help to maintain compliance and ensure that stock options remain priced appropriately according to current market conditions.
